Three train crew members were injured in an emergency on a railway bridge near Zheleznogorsk in the Kursk region. This was announced on June 1 by the acting governor of the region, Alexander Khinshtein.
He clarified that the train crew, the driver and two assistants had been diagnosed with numerous bruises.
"All of them were taken to Zheleznogorsk hospital last night. They were examined by doctors. The condition is satisfactory," Khinstein wrote on his Telegram channel.
The governor added that the railway management had sent people to the Russian Railways Medicine Design Bureau in Kursk, where the victims were provided with all necessary medical and psychological support.
According to Izvestia correspondent Tatiana Simonenkova, investigative actions are currently taking place behind the cordon.
In the Kursk region, a bridge collapsed on June 1 during the movement of a freight train. Some of the wagons fell onto the highway under the bridge. A criminal case was opened on this fact.
